Enhancing Regional Hospital in Jendouba with Modern Medical Equipment for Benefit of Citizens

The Jendouba Governorate has taken a significant step toward improving healthcare services by equipping the regional hospital with advanced medical devices, at a cost of nearly 2 million dinars, financed by the Ministry of Health.

This development will enable faster diagnosis, more precise treatment, and ease the suffering of patients, especially in the interior regions.

Key New Equipment:

  • A blood coagulation analyzer (CS1600)
  • NFS device for blood disease analysis (DXH690T and Sysmex XN)
  • Advanced biochemistry analyzer (Beckman Coulter)
  • Device for measuring blood sugar levels (HbA1c)
  • Microscope with a screen to facilitate diagnosis and medical training
  • Acoustic isolation room for hearing tests
  • Light tunnel for treating jaundice in newborns

The goal of these new devices is to:

  • Reduce waiting times,
  • Improve diagnostic accuracy,
  • Alleviate pressure on university hospitals,
  • Bring healthcare services closer to citizens.

 

The Ministry of Health explained that this accomplishment is part of the state’s vision to enhance health equity and is in line with the directives of President Kais Saied to strengthen the public health sector in the interior regions.
